Application Techniques: Mastering the Art of Nail Embellishments

Proper application is crucial for ensuring that your nail charms and rhinestones stay in place and look their best. While the process might seem simple, there are a few key techniques to master for achieving professional-looking results. The first, and perhaps most important, step is to prepare your nails properly. This involves cleaning your nails thoroughly, pushing back your cuticles, and lightly buffing the surface to create a slightly rough texture that will help the adhesive grip. After preparing your nails, apply a base coat and allow it to dry completely. This provides a smooth surface for the adhesive and helps protect your natural nails from damage. Next, choose a high-quality nail glue or gel adhesive. FANDAMEI offers a variety of adhesives specifically designed for nail art, so be sure to select one that is compatible with the type of charms and rhinestones you are using. Apply a small dot of adhesive to the nail surface where you want to place the charm or rhinestone. Use a wax pencil or rhinestone picker to carefully pick up the embellishment and place it onto the adhesive. Gently press down on the embellishment to ensure that it is securely attached. If using nail glue, allow the glue to dry completely before applying a top coat. If using gel adhesive, cure the gel under a UV or LED lamp according to the manufacturer’s instructions. Finally, apply a generous layer of top coat to seal in the charms and rhinestones and protect them from damage. Be sure to coat the entire nail surface, including the edges of the embellishments. This will help prevent them from snagging or falling off.

Here are some additional tips for achieving flawless nail embellishment application:

* Use a small amount of adhesive to avoid overflowing and creating a messy look.
* Place the charms and rhinestones strategically to create a balanced and visually appealing design.
* Use a variety of sizes and shapes of embellishments to add depth and dimension to your nail art.
* Clean up any excess adhesive with a cotton swab dipped in acetone.
* Regularly check your nail art and reapply top coat as needed to maintain its shine and durability.

How do I safely remove nail charms and rhinestones without damaging my natural nails?

Removing nail charms and rhinestones requires patience and care to avoid damaging your natural nails. The key is to gently dissolve the adhesive without forcefully pulling off the embellishments. Soak a cotton ball in acetone (100% acetone is most effective) and place it directly on top of the charm or rhinestone. Secure the cotton ball with a piece of foil, wrapping it tightly around your fingertip. This will help to keep the acetone in contact with the adhesive and prevent it from evaporating too quickly. Allow the acetone to soak for 10-15 minutes. This will soften the adhesive, making it easier to remove the embellishments. After soaking, gently try to wiggle the charm or rhinestone loose. If it doesn’t come off easily, soak for a few more minutes. Once the charm or rhinestone is loose, use a wooden or plastic cuticle pusher to carefully lift it off the nail. Avoid using metal tools, as they can scratch or damage the nail surface. After removing all the embellishments, buff your nails to smooth out any rough edges or remaining adhesive. Finally, apply cuticle oil to rehydrate your nails and cuticles.

Are FANDAMEI nail charms and rhinestones safe for sensitive skin?

The safety of FANDAMEI nail charms and rhinestones for sensitive skin depends on the materials used and individual sensitivities. While FANDAMEI generally uses high-quality materials, some individuals may still experience allergic reactions to certain metals or adhesives. It’s essential to review the product descriptions carefully, paying attention to the materials used in both the charms/rhinestones and the recommended adhesives. If you have known allergies to specific metals like nickel, opt for charms made from hypoallergenic materials such as surgical steel or titanium. Before applying any charms or rhinestones, perform a patch test by applying a small amount of the adhesive to a small area of your skin (like the inside of your wrist) and waiting 24-48 hours to see if any irritation develops. Avoid prolonged contact with harsh chemicals and ensure proper ventilation during application and removal. If you experience any redness, itching, or swelling after applying nail charms or rhinestones, remove them immediately and consult a dermatologist. Opting for reputable brands and following proper application and removal techniques can minimize the risk of allergic reactions.

What tools do I need to apply nail charms and rhinestones effectively?

Applying nail charms and rhinestones effectively requires a few essential tools to ensure precision, control, and a professional finish. First, a quality nail glue or gel adhesive is paramount for secure attachment. Choose one formulated for nail art. A wax pencil or rhinestone picker is invaluable for picking up and placing small charms and rhinestones with accuracy, preventing smudging or fingerprints. A cuticle pusher (wooden or plastic) helps to gently nudge charms into place and remove excess glue. Small, sharp scissors or nippers may be needed to trim excess adhesive or adjust the size of charms. A UV or LED lamp is necessary for curing gel adhesives. Finally, a clean-up brush (small and angled) dipped in acetone helps remove any excess glue or stray glitter.
